The aim of the present study was to investigate the potential effects of glyphosate on the gastrointestinal microbial ecology of pigs fed a diet, not amended with tryptophan. Glyphosate inhibits a step in the shikimate pathway, providing precursors for synthesis of aromatic amino acids (tryptophan, phenylalanine, and tyrosine). If these amino acids are sufficiently present in the environment, microorganisms may utilize them; if not present in sufficient amounts, the microorganisms depend on intracellular amino acid synthesis, involving the shikimate pathway, and may thus be more sensitive to glyphosate.
